
My Heavenly Father Loves Me
Lyrics
Whenever I hear the song of a bird
Or look at a blue, blue sky,
Whenever I feel the rain on my face
Or the wind as it rushes by,
Whenever I touch a velvet rose
Or walk by a lilac tree,
I'm glad that I live in this beautiful world
Heav'nly Father created for me.
He gave me my eyes that I might see
The colorful butterfly wings.
He gave me my ears that I might hear
The magical sound of things.
He gave me my life, my mind, my heart:
I thank him reverently
For all his creations, of which I'm a part.
Yes, I know Heav'nly Father loves me.
Yes, I know,
Yes, I know my Heav'nly Father loves me.
Written by Clara W. McMaster
1904–1997. © 1961 IRI. Arr. © 1989 IRI
